Grizzlies hand George Brown their second loss of season in OT
Toronto, ON -- Grizzlies hand George Brown their second loss of season in overtime thriller.
The first half was a close battle. George Brown outscored the Grizzlies by two at the end of the first quarter and led by four entering halftime.
Georgian seemed determined to cut into the lead as the second half was underway. Emanuel Otong (Cambridge, ON), one of two new additions to the Grizzlies' men's basketball roster, was the standout player in this game, scoring an impressive 43 points and collecting 15 rebounds, contributing significantly to his team's victory. Uzziah Glasgow (Vaughan, ON) also contributed 16 points to the Grizzlies impressive win.
The Grizzlies clawed back in the late minutes of the game and tied the game at 83. Georgian had the final possession with 13 seconds left. Glasgow had a chance to win the game for the Grizzlies, but missed a well-contested three point shot as time expired and forcing overtime.
Overtime was all Georgian. The Grizzlies played spectacular defense, forcing turnovers and contesting shots, leading to a 99-91 victory over the division leading George Brown Huskies.
In terms of shooting percentages, Georgian College had a field goal percentage of 43.2% compared to George Brown's 40.8%. However, George Brown had a higher three-point shooting percentage at 34.2% compared to Georgian's 17.9%. Both teams had similar free throw percentages, with Georgian College shooting at 66.7% and George Brown at 59.3%.
George Brown's first loss of the season also came against the Grizzlies on October 25, 2023.
